CryptoFutures — Trading Guide 2026

Rate limiting strategies

## Rate Limiting Strategies in Crypto Futures Trading

Rate limiting is a crucial concept for any trader engaging with cryptocurrency futures exchanges. While often discussed in the context of API access for algorithmic traders, understanding rate limits is essential even for manual traders to avoid disruptions and optimize their trading experience. This article provides a comprehensive overview of rate limiting in the crypto futures space, covering its purpose, types, implications, and strategies to navigate it effectively.

What is Rate Limiting?

At its core, rate limiting is a strategy employed by exchanges to control the number of requests a user (or an IP address) can make to their servers within a specific timeframe. Think of it as a traffic control system for data. Exchanges aren’t trying to hinder traders; rather, they’re protecting their infrastructure from overload. A sudden surge in requests, perhaps from a poorly designed trading bot or a Distributed Denial of Service (DDoS) attack, can overwhelm the exchange’s servers, leading to slower response times for all users, order failures, and even a complete outage.

Rate limits are implemented for several key reasons:

Example Scenario: A Simple Order Placement Bot

Let’s imagine a simple bot designed to place market orders based on a moving average crossover. Without rate limiting considerations, the bot might continuously check the price, calculate the moving average, and attempt to place an order whenever a crossover occurs. This could quickly exhaust the exchange's rate limit.

A rate-limiting-aware bot would:

1. **Check Rate Limit:** Before each API call (e.g., fetching price data, placing an order), the bot would check its remaining rate limit. 2. **Queue Requests:** If the rate limit is low, the bot would add the request to a queue. 3. **Exponential Backoff:** If a request is rejected, the bot would implement an exponential backoff strategy before retrying. 4. **Adjust Frequency:** The bot would dynamically adjust its request frequency based on the current rate limit and market conditions.

Conclusion

Rate limiting is an unavoidable aspect of trading on cryptocurrency futures exchanges. Understanding how it works, its impact on your strategies, and implementing effective management techniques are crucial for success. By proactively addressing rate limits, you can ensure the stability and reliability of your trading operations and avoid missed opportunities. Remember to always consult the exchange’s documentation and adhere to their terms of service. Mastering rate limiting is not just a technical skill; it's a key component of responsible and profitable trading in the dynamic world of crypto futures. Understanding trading volume and its impact on exchange load can also help anticipate rate limit pressures.

Category:Rate Limiting

Recommended Futures Trading Platforms

Platform Futures Features Register
Binance Futures Leverage up to 125x, USDⓈ-M contracts Register now
Bybit Futures Perpetual inverse contracts Start trading
BingX Futures Copy trading Join BingX
Bitget Futures USDT-margined contracts Open account
BitMEX Cryptocurrency platform, leverage up to 100x BitMEX

Join Our Community

Subscribe to the Telegram channel @strategybin for more information. Best profit platforms – register now.

Participate in Our Community

Subscribe to the Telegram channel @cryptofuturestrading for analysis, free signals, and more